The Kent Stage, established in 1927, is a historic theater in downtown Kent, Ohio, serving as a premier venue for a variety of events, including concerts, festivals, and private functions. Managed by the Western Reserve Folk Arts Association since 2002, it boasts a 642-seat capacity and hosts around 150 concerts annually, alongside the Kent Folk, Blues, Reggae, and Around Town Music Festivals. The venue features All Folked Up, a full-service bar, allowing beverages in the theater. Tickets are sold online, with box office and phone options available. The ONLY official ticket outlet is available at the website. Doors open one hour before the concert. Age policies vary by event, with ID required.
